statchute.xyz
756 Subscribers
416844 Views
1391 Videos
None
#2380
Subscriber Rank
#1714
View Rank
#1079
Video Rank
1 +0%
Subs in the last 30 days
1888 -60.4%
Views in the last 30 days
0%
Videos in the last 30 days